Output 64e8dbaae826d4309e5135a16bb41b16d4e455a1d4def89d53d7b835e59b706e:1

value
3563711
script pubkey
OP_0 OP_PUSHBYTES_20 3fb43ca4b95b0c9cfa1e189c5abb9a6abc932cd0
address
bc1q876ref9etvxfe7s7rzw94wu6d27fxtxsvnyqt8
transaction
64e8dbaae826d4309e5135a16bb41b16d4e455a1d4def89d53d7b835e59b706e
spent
true